Output 68b770f309b7dc2612b50d693650e5bf9afb8bdd1a03dc2f89b3bb349db5ba96:12

value
3743920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d9afa713ed34a44aa8670fcf3c6a234ec452267 OP_EQUAL
address
3G4Mfjxm3SpNiNEFq6o1XRn3pNzZhW45b6
transaction
68b770f309b7dc2612b50d693650e5bf9afb8bdd1a03dc2f89b3bb349db5ba96
confirmations
274406
spent
true